Instructions
Place sweet potatoes in a large saucepan; cover with water to 2 inches above potatoes. Bring to a boil over high; reduce heat to medium-low, and simmer until tender, about 18 minutes. Remove from heat. Drain and return potatoes to saucepan.
Combine butter and olive oil in a small skillet over medium; cook until browned and fragrant, about 3 minutes. Remove from heat; stir in thyme.
Add milk, salt, and pepper to sweet potatoes; mash with a potato masher to desired consistency. Drizzle with butter mixture; gently stir once or twice. Garnish with thyme leaves.
